Transaction d69ab430a606b321c4ca4e09d020b5b3e4a368dd676b7530010e12f69dba1a6c
1 Input
1 Output
-
d69ab430a606b321c4ca4e09d020b5b3e4a368dd676b7530010e12f69dba1a6c:0
- value
- 583674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96c73096286aa8d3377eb847c40782aa2bf152f0 OP_EQUAL
- address
- 3FSFuGUbnwXtZuuZd7DX5g7hfK6PW9APDz